Police issues advisory about international numbers spreading misinformation about G20 meet

Srinagar, May 19 (PTI) The police in Kashmir have issued a public advisory against suspicious international mobile numbers allegedly being used to spread rumours about next week’s meeting of the G20 tourism track in the Valley. ED seizes funds worth Rs 8.26 crore of Chinese-owned education company in Bengaluru

New Delhi, May 19 (PTI) The Enforcement Directorate on Friday said it has seized funds worth Rs 8.26 crore of a Bengaluru-based online education company, fully owned and controlled by Chinese nationals, as part of a probe linked to the alleged contravention of the foreign exchange law. Global stroke deaths could increase to nearly 5 million by 2030: Study

New Delhi, May 19 (PTI) The number of deaths worldwide from ischemic stroke is expected to increase to nearly five million by 2030, according to a study. Active Covid cases in country dip to 9,092

New Delhi, May 19 (PTI) India has recorded 865 new coronavirus infections, while the active cases have decreased to 9,092 from 10,179, according to the Union Health Ministry data updated on Friday.
